With Yuvraj Singh's injury-forced ouster disturbing their settled line-up, India have been left with a selection dilemma to handle as they gear up to take on the flamboyant and unpredictable West Indies in what promises to be a battle of nerves in the World Twenty20 semifinal in Mumbai on Thursday. Yuvraj, who has not got big runs but was involved in crucial stands with top performer Virat Kohli during the group stage matches, has been ruled out owing to an ankle injury that he sustained in the must-win game against Australia. Manish Pandey, not in the original 15, has been penciled in to replace the all-rounder in the squad although Ajinkya Rahane is also present as a viable alternative. But it remains to be seen whether skipper Mahendra Singh Dhoni chooses between the two or decides to go with rookie all-rounder Pawan Negi.

Defending champions the West Indies trounced Pakistan by 84 runs on Tuesday to set up a semi-final meeting with Sri Lanka in the ICC World Twenty20. Led by a late charge from Dwayne Bravo (46) and skipper Darren Sammy (42 not out) the West Indies put up an impressive 166 for six after electing to bat and then shot out Pakistan for a meagre 85 in 17.5 overs.
